An inextensible cable of negligible mass is used to drag a log on a rough horizontal surface. The tension in the cable is 850 N and it acts at an angle of 35° to the horizontal. The log is dragged over a distance of 45m. The frictional force experienced by the log is 150 N. a) Define the term work. b) Calculate the net work done on the log.
a) Define the term work: this is a physical quantity that shows how much energy was transferred to or from a system by applying a force along some path.
